Ending up being an orthodontist is a challenging yet rewarding journey that needs years of education and learning, training, and commitment.
The next action is to attend an approved oral school, which normally requires four years of research study. Their education culminates in a two to three-year orthodontic residency program that incorporates advanced coursework with hands-on medical experience dealing with people under guidance. What is the distinction between a dental professional and her comment is here an orthodontist? To address a question that is usually asked, both dental professionals and orthodontists assist people get better oral health and wellness, albeit in various means. It aids to bear in mind that dentistry is an instead wide scientific research with various medical specializations. All dentists, consisting of orthodontists, deal with the teeth, periodontals, jaw and nerves.
You can assume of both physicians that deal with periodontal and teeth troubles. The primary difference is that becoming an orthodontist calls for a certain specialty in dealing with the misalignment of the teeth and jaw.

Orthodontists function on a particular collection of oral troubles, indicating they deal with imbalances in the teeth and various other relevant irregularities. A few of the conditions that they treat include the following: Jaw imbalance Teeth that are as well far apart Jampacked teeth Overbites Underbites Uneven teeth As you can see, these specify sorts of dental problems besides the typical issues basic dental experts manage
